In today’s digital age, emojis have become a ubiquitous form of communication, often conveying emotions more effectively than text. But have you ever wondered how we could harness this rich emotional data for more profound insights? Enter Emoji Intelligence, a pioneering project on GitHub that aims to decode emotions embedded in emojis using advanced AI techniques.

Origin and Importance

The Emoji Intelligence project was born out of the need to understand and utilize the emotional context in digital communications. Developed by Bilal Reffas, this project targets both developers and researchers interested in sentiment analysis and emotional data processing. Its significance lies in its potential to enhance user experiences, improve mental health applications, and provide valuable insights in market research.

Core Features and Implementation

  1. Emoji Recognition: The project employs state-of-the-art convolutional neural networks (CNNs) to accurately identify and classify emojis from images and text. This feature is crucial for applications that require real-time emoji detection.

  2. Sentiment Analysis: Leveraging natural language processing (NLP), the project analyzes the sentiment associated with each emoji. This is particularly useful in social media monitoring and customer feedback analysis.

  3. Emotion Interpretation: By mapping emojis to specific emotional states, the project provides a deeper understanding of user emotions. This functionality is vital for creating empathetic chatbots and personalized content delivery systems.

  4. Data Visualization: The project includes interactive dashboards that visualize emotional trends and patterns, making it easier for users to interpret complex data.

Real-World Applications

One notable application of Emoji Intelligence is in the mental health sector. By analyzing emojis in patient communications, therapists can gain additional insights into emotional states, aiding in more accurate diagnoses and personalized treatment plans. Additionally, marketing teams have utilized this tool to gauge customer sentiments on social media, leading to more targeted advertising strategies.

Advantages Over Similar Tools

Compared to other emotion analysis tools, Emoji Intelligence stands out due to its:

  • Advanced AI Models: The use of CNNs and NLP ensures high accuracy and reliability.
  • Scalability: The project is designed to handle large datasets, making it suitable for enterprise-level applications.
  • Open Source Nature: Being open source, it allows for continuous improvement and customization by the community.

Performance metrics have shown that Emoji Intelligence achieves over 90% accuracy in emoji recognition and sentiment analysis, outperforming many commercial solutions.

Summary and Future Outlook

Emoji Intelligence has proven to be a valuable asset in decoding emotional data, offering practical solutions across various industries. As the project continues to evolve, we can expect even more sophisticated features, such as context-aware emotion detection and integration with VR/AR technologies.

Call to Action

Are you intrigued by the potential of emotional data analysis? Dive into the Emoji Intelligence project on GitHub and contribute to the future of AI-driven emotion recognition. Explore the repository at Emoji Intelligence GitHub and join the community shaping the next frontier of digital empathy.

By embracing projects like Emoji Intelligence, we can unlock new dimensions of human-computer interaction, making technology not just smarter, but more empathetic.